Review of Red Mission

Red Mission (2015)
2/10
Plot-less, without point or ending
10 October 2016
That this was reportedly done on a $200 budget is impressive of itself, but with modern day digital cameras and a trip to the thrift store, that's entirely possible these days. Sadly, even that seems $200 wasted.

This is yet another short with no real plot, no resolution, explanation or ending. It would seem the $200 budget ran out and someone called, "That's a wrap!" Then to add insult to time-wasting injury, there's a post-credit clip that's even more pointless than the flick itself.

Richards is reasonably played by John O'Hagan. Shamus Jarvis as Hudson is reminiscent of the best schlock acting of Dark Star, but unfortunately was not intended as comedic in this film.

In short, 24 minutes you could better spend doing dishes. Nothing to see here. Move along. Move along.
